O reconhecimento automático de conteúdo (ACR) é uma tecnologia que identifica conteúdo reproduzido em um dispositivo ou presente em um ambiente digital. Isso pode ser qualquer coisa, desde áudio e vídeo até imagens digitais. A tecnologia ACR usa identificadores exclusivos no conteúdo para determinar o que ele é e pode ser aproveitada para inúmeras aplicações, como rastreamento de conteúdo, sincronização de dispositivos secundários, medição de audiência e muito mais.
A Gênese do Reconhecimento Automático de Conteúdo
As origens do Reconhecimento Automático de Conteúdo (ACR) estão interligadas com a evolução da tecnologia e mídia digital. Foi durante o final dos anos 1990 e início dos anos 2000, com o surgimento da mídia digital e da Internet, que a ideia do ACR começou a criar raízes. A primeira aplicação concreta do ACR remonta ao aplicativo Shazam, que foi desenvolvido em 2002. O aplicativo foi projetado para reconhecer músicas ouvindo um pequeno trecho de áudio, marcando um avanço significativo no desenvolvimento da tecnologia ACR.
Aprofunde-se no reconhecimento automático de conteúdo
A tecnologia de reconhecimento automático de conteúdo funciona digitalizando, analisando e combinando conteúdo com um banco de dados conhecido. Os sistemas ACR utilizam várias técnicas, como marca d’água digital, impressão digital e aprendizado de máquina para identificar conteúdo. Eles podem ser implementados em software, hardware ou uma combinação de ambos e podem identificar conteúdo em vários canais e formatos, incluindo transmissão, OTT e DVR.
O ACR encontrou inúmeras aplicações em vários setores. Por exemplo, na indústria de mídia e entretenimento, o ACR ajuda na sincronização de conteúdo, publicidade interativa, recomendação de conteúdo e medição de audiência. Também é usado na conformidade de conteúdo e na aplicação do gerenciamento de direitos digitais.
A estrutura interna do reconhecimento automático de conteúdo
A operação do sistema de reconhecimento automático de conteúdo envolve uma sequência de etapas:
- Aquisição de dados: envolve a captura do conteúdo em questão.
- Extração de recursos: aqui, identificadores exclusivos ou 'recursos' são extraídos do conteúdo.
- Correspondência: os recursos extraídos são então comparados com um banco de dados de conteúdo conhecido para identificar uma correspondência.
- Resposta: Depois que uma correspondência é encontrada, o sistema gera uma resposta ou saída apropriada.
Os principais componentes de um sistema ACR incluem o módulo de extração de recursos, o banco de dados e o algoritmo de correspondência. A precisão do sistema depende muito da eficiência destes componentes.
Principais recursos de reconhecimento automático de conteúdo
-
Operação em tempo real: Os sistemas ACR são capazes de identificar conteúdo em tempo real, tornando-os altamente eficazes para aplicações como sincronização de TV ao vivo e publicidade interativa.
-
Independência da plataforma: Eles podem operar em diversas plataformas, canais e formatos, proporcionando versatilidade.
-
Robustez: Os sistemas ACR são projetados para identificar com precisão o conteúdo, mesmo em condições ruidosas ou degradadas.
-
Escalabilidade: Eles podem lidar com grandes quantidades de dados e aumentar à medida que o banco de dados de conteúdo conhecido cresce.
Tipos de reconhecimento automático de conteúdo
Existem basicamente três tipos de tecnologias ACR:
-
Marca d'água de áudio: Isto envolve incorporar um identificador único e invisível no conteúdo de áudio. Este identificador pode ser detectado e extraído por um sistema ACR.
-
Impressão digital digital: Aqui, características únicas ou “impressões digitais” do conteúdo são extraídas e utilizadas para reconhecimento.
-
ACR baseado em aprendizado de máquina: Esses sistemas aproveitam algoritmos de aprendizado de máquina para identificar e classificar conteúdo.
Maneiras de usar reconhecimento automático de conteúdo e problemas/soluções
O ACR tem diversas aplicações em vários setores. É usado em smart TVs para recomendação de conteúdo, em publicidade para campanhas publicitárias interativas e no gerenciamento de direitos digitais para conformidade de conteúdo.
No entanto, o ACR também apresenta alguns desafios. Foram levantadas preocupações de privacidade relativamente aos dados recolhidos pelos sistemas ACR, e também existem questões relacionadas com a precisão da identificação do conteúdo, especialmente em condições ruidosas.
As soluções para esses problemas envolvem o aprimoramento dos protocolos de privacidade e a melhoria contínua dos algoritmos de reconhecimento e da robustez do sistema. Legislação e regulamentos também estão sendo estabelecidos em muitos países para abordar estas preocupações.
Reconhecimento Automático de Conteúdo: Principais Características e Comparações
Recurso | Reconhecimento Automático de Conteúdo | Outras tecnologias semelhantes |
---|---|---|
Operação em tempo real | Sim | Pode variar |
Precisão | Alto | Pode variar |
Independência de plataforma | Sim | Pode variar |
Preocupações com a privacidade | Sim | Depende da tecnologia |
Escalabilidade | Alto | Depende da tecnologia |
Perspectivas Futuras e Tecnologias em Reconhecimento Automático de Conteúdo
O futuro da tecnologia ACR é promissor, com avanços no aprendizado de máquina e na IA previstos para aprimorar ainda mais suas capacidades. No futuro, podemos esperar sistemas ACR mais precisos e rápidos, capazes de lidar com conteúdos cada vez mais complexos em múltiplas plataformas.
Além disso, a integração da tecnologia blockchain poderia potencialmente abordar questões de privacidade e segurança de dados, fornecendo uma estrutura descentralizada e segura para o gerenciamento de dados coletados por sistemas ACR.
Servidores proxy e reconhecimento automático de conteúdo
Os servidores proxy podem desempenhar um papel vital no funcionamento dos sistemas ACR. Ao rotear solicitações por meio de um servidor proxy, é possível gerenciar e controlar o fluxo de dados de e para um sistema ACR. Isso pode melhorar a segurança, gerenciar a carga do sistema e também fornecer camadas adicionais de anonimato, abordando ainda mais questões de privacidade.
Além disso, a distribuição global de servidores proxy pode ajudar na diversificação geográfica do reconhecimento de conteúdos, ajudando a criar sistemas ACR mais versáteis e robustos.